Stephen Kellogg and the Sixers

Stephen Kellogg and the Sixers' on stage credits include tours with George Thorogood, Needtobreathe, Sugarland, Hanson, O.A.R., Josh Ritter, Dar Williams, David Crosby, Martin Sexton as well as an appearance with James Brown shortly before Brown's death.

The band's touring history also includes several trips overseas to play for the United States Armed Forces.

After over twelve-hundred shows and nine years of playing together as a band 'Stephen Kellogg and the Sixers' went on hiatus at the end of November 2012.

As of December 2012 Stephen Kellogg has been touring extensively, having released his first solo album, Blunderstone Rookery in 2013.
